Where does “toissilmäinen” come from?

toissilmäinen (Finnish) comes from Finnish toinen, from Proto-Finnic toinen, from Proto-Finnic too, from Proto-Uralic to — that.

toissilmäinen (Finnish): one-eyed

Definitions

  1. one-eyed
